When a UPS malfunctions or it's time for maintenance, the most critical question is:
Should I go to an authorized service center or a private repair shop?
The answer is not a single word .
The right choice depends on the UPS's age, warranty, the system it powers, and the type of fault.

What is an Authorized Service Center?
Authorized service:
-
This is the official service provider for the UPS manufacturer.
-
Uses original parts.
-
It manages the warranty processes.
-
It operates according to manufacturer standards.
📌 In short: it's the brand's official channel.
What is Special Service?
Special service:
-
It does not depend on the manufacturer.
-
Multiple brands service UPS.
-
It is more flexible and faster.
-
The possibility of on-site intervention is high.
📌 In short: it's an independent but experience-based solution.
Advantages of Using an Authorized Service Center ✅
-
🔒 If your warranty is still valid, this is the only correct address.
-
🔧 100% original part
-
📄 Transaction in producer records
-
🧠 Brand-specific trained technicians
📌 For new and guaranteed UPS systems, authorized service centers should be preferred .
Disadvantages of Authorized Service Centers ❌
-
⏱️ The durations may be long.
-
💰 Costs are generally high.
-
🏢 On-site intervention is limited.
-
🔁 Flexibility is low (procedure-heavy)
👉 It's common to see situations where even a simple battery replacement requires a service center.

Advantages of Special Service ✅
-
⚡ Fast response (often the same day)
-
🏢 On-site service available
-
💸 More flexible costs
-
🔍 Evaluating the battery, UPS, and environment together.
-
🧪 Detailed maintenance including load testing and thermal imaging.
📌 It makes much more sense with out-of-warranty UPSs.
Disadvantages of Private Service ❌
-
❗ Quality varies greatly from company to company.
-
❌ Risk of unauthorized and inexperienced service.
-
🔧 Original parts may not be available (please inquire)
👉 Avoid services that offer "cheap prices" but don't perform testing.
Which one should you choose and when?
🟢 Choose an Authorized Service Center If:
-
If the UPS is under warranty
-
If manufacturer software/firmware intervention is required
-
If official registration and warranty continuation are important.
The Most Common Mistake ❌
"Authorized service is always better."
Real:
-
Guaranteed UPS → Yes
-
5-7 years of UPS experience → No, often a private service is more sensible.

How do you recognize the right private service?
Ask these questions:
-
Do you perform load testing?
-
Are you using a thermal camera?
-
Do you provide a post-maintenance report?
-
Can you explain the difference between original and aftermarket parts?
If there are no clear answers to these questions → the service is poor .
